
Continuemos explorando las funcionalidades ofrecidas por Aspose.Page para Java. Dado que ya sabemos que necesitamos una aplicación de terceros para ver/procesar archivos PostScript. Sin embargo, convertirlos a formatos de archivo de imagen sin duda eliminará este problema. Por lo tanto, esta publicación de blog recorrerá la implementación de la conversión de PS a PNG usando Aspose.Page para Java. Involucra unas pocas líneas de código fuente de Java para desarrollar un convertidor de PS a PNG programáticamente. Ahora, saltemos a la instalación y luego escribamos un ejemplo de código para convertir PostScript a PNG en Java.
Este artículo involucra los siguientes puntos:
- Instalación del SDK de PostScript de Java
- Convertir PostScript a PNG en Java
- Convertidor de PS a PNG - Aplicación en línea
Instalación del SDK de PostScript de Java
Entonces, puedes descargar este archivo JAR o usar las configuraciones de Maven mencionadas a continuación. Además, hay instrucciones completas de instalación y uso dadas aquí.
<repositories>
<repository>
<id>AsposeJavaAPI</id>
<name>Aspose Java API</name>
<url>https://releases.aspose.com/java/repo/</url>
</repository>
</repositories>
<dependencies>
<dependency>
<groupId>com.aspose</groupId>
<artifactId>aspose-page</artifactId>
<version>23.12</version>
</dependency>
</dependencies>
Convertir PostScript a PNG en Java
Bien, suficiente con la teoría, veamos algo de código. Pero antes de continuar, asegúrate de tener un archivo PostScript de origen para probar la funcionalidad.
Los siguientes pasos muestran cómo convertir PS a PNG programáticamente:
- Primero, establece el ImageFormat en PNG y carga el archivo PostScript (PS) de origen.
- Crea una instancia de la clase PsDocument con el flujo de entrada de PostScript.
- Puedes establecer el valor de suppressErrors si deseas convertir el archivo PostScript a pesar de errores menores.
- Inicializa una nueva instancia de la clase ImageSaveOptions con el parámetro suppressErrors.
- Instancia un objeto de la clase ImageDevice.
- Invoca el método save para guardar el archivo PNG en el disco.
- Llama al método getImagesBytes para obtener las imágenes resultantes en bytes.
- Ahora, crea un flujo de salida inicializando una instancia de la clase FileOutputStream con la ruta de la imagen de salida.
Salida:
Convertidor de PS a PNG - Aplicación en línea
Hasta ahora, has visto cómo este SDK de PostScript de Java ofrece conversión programática. Ahora, la otra cosa interesante sobre esta biblioteca es que también proporciona una herramienta en línea para convertir archivos PostScript a formatos de archivo de imagen. Sobre todo, este convertidor de PS a PNG es gratuito y puedes usarlo abriéndolo en cualquier navegador web.

Obtén una Licencia Gratuita
Puedes obtener una licencia temporal gratuita para probar este SDK de PostScript de Java sin limitaciones de evaluación.
Resumiendo
Estamos cerrando esta guía aquí. Para comenzar, visita la documentación, las referencias de API y el repositorio de GitHub. Hemos cubierto cómo convertir PostScript a PNG en Java utilizando Aspose.Page para Java. Además, esta publicación de blog es un esfuerzo por presentar este SDK de PostScript de Java como una solución y esperamos que te ayude a desarrollar un convertidor de PS a PNG para tu aplicación empresarial. Por último, mantente conectado con aspose.com para actualizaciones regulares.
No dudes en ponerte en contacto
Puedes hacernos saber tus preguntas o consultas en nuestro foro.